当前位置: 首页 > news >正文

VSCode正则表达式匹配字符串,并批量替换字符串

例如我要替换如下所示的字符串,前半部分相同,后面的值不同:

"LONG_NE_CNT": "36",
...
"LONG_NE_CNT": "136",
...
"LONG_NE_CNT": "326",
...

我可以使用正则表达式这样匹配字符串:

LONG_NE_CNT":(.*)

首先,VACode中ctrl+H打开搜索替换框,在搜索框里面输入上面的正则表达式:

 其中:

. 匹配除换行符 \n 之外的任何单字符。要匹配 . ,请使用 \. 。

* 匹配前面的子表达式零次或多次。要匹配 * 字符,请使用 \*。

然后,在替换框中使用$1替换(.*)作为占位,点击全部替换即可:

相关文章:

  • 解决idea编辑器全集搜索快捷键Ctrl+shift+f无效
  • 解决Chrome浏览器控制台请求返回值中的中文显示为乱码的问题
  • vue+ elementUI纯前端下载excel文件模板
  • 多人协作开发使用git基于master创建本地新分支避免同一分支代码提交时冲突
  • git合并master到自己的分支
  • React根据数组对象渲染DOM元素,页面不显示DOM元素
  • git从master建立分支
  • Vuex:Computed property “xxx“ was assigned to but it has no setter.
  • git commit提交代码是报错:running pre-commit hook: npm run precommit解决办法
  • js三层数组循环遍历(笛卡尔积)运算,并生成顺序
  • ERROR in ./src/.umi/core/routes.ts 402:19-404:109Module not found: Error: [CaseSensitivePathsPlugin
  • 响应式布局
  • GIT安装与使用
  • 初识微信小程序
  • 初步微信小程序
  • JavaScript 如何正确处理 Unicode 编码问题!
  • 03Go 类型总结
  • CSS选择器——伪元素选择器之处理父元素高度及外边距溢出
  • ES学习笔记(10)--ES6中的函数和数组补漏
  • javascript从右向左截取指定位数字符的3种方法
  • learning koa2.x
  • MySQL QA
  • Nodejs和JavaWeb协助开发
  • Spring Boot快速入门(一):Hello Spring Boot
  • SSH 免密登录
  • 诡异!React stopPropagation失灵
  • 记一次用 NodeJs 实现模拟登录的思路
  • 聊聊flink的TableFactory
  • 悄悄地说一个bug
  • 深度学习在携程攻略社区的应用
  • 怎么将电脑中的声音录制成WAV格式
  • zabbix3.2监控linux磁盘IO
  • ​卜东波研究员:高观点下的少儿计算思维
  • #{}和${}的区别是什么 -- java面试
  • #我与Java虚拟机的故事#连载11: JVM学习之路
  • (22)C#传智:复习,多态虚方法抽象类接口,静态类,String与StringBuilder,集合泛型List与Dictionary,文件类,结构与类的区别
  • (3)(3.5) 遥测无线电区域条例
  • (笔试题)合法字符串
  • (二)丶RabbitMQ的六大核心
  • (分享)自己整理的一些简单awk实用语句
  • (附源码)计算机毕业设计SSM智能化管理的仓库管理
  • (六)c52学习之旅-独立按键
  • (没学懂,待填坑)【动态规划】数位动态规划
  • (生成器)yield与(迭代器)generator
  • (四) Graphivz 颜色选择
  • (四)搭建容器云管理平台笔记—安装ETCD(不使用证书)
  • (终章)[图像识别]13.OpenCV案例 自定义训练集分类器物体检测
  • .NET Core WebAPI中使用swagger版本控制,添加注释
  • .net mvc部分视图
  • .net 中viewstate的原理和使用
  • .net开发引用程序集提示没有强名称的解决办法
  • /*在DataTable中更新、删除数据*/
  • ??eclipse的安装配置问题!??
  • @RequestMapping用法详解
  • @SentinelResource详解